• Nanozyme destroys virus in human cells and in mice

    Updated: 2012-07-30 18:14:49
    Nanotechnology combines an enzyme and a DNA molecule on the surface of gold nanoparticles to destroy hepatitis C virus in human cells and in a mouse model of disease.

  • EPA Extends Due Date for Comments on Nanosilver Registration Review

    Updated: 2012-07-17 06:57:13
    According to a July 10, 2012, memorandum added to the registration review docket for nanosilver, the Federal Register notice announcing the opening of the docket erroneously listed the comment period end date as August 19, 2012. he U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) memorandum states that the comment period has been extended to September 10, 2012, “to allow for a full 60-day comment period [that] is standard for registration review docket openings.”

  • Atomically precise nanoparticle provides better drug delivery

    Updated: 2012-07-10 20:09:48
    Nanoparticles made from specific DNA and RNA strands, homogeneous in size, composition, and surface chemistry, proved superior to other nanoparticles in silencing gene expression in tumors in mouse experiments.

  • Nanomachines and molecular motors can make use of thermal noise

    Updated: 2012-07-03 19:08:07
    A theoretical study shows that although thermal noise cannot be used to produce useful motion by mesoscale or macroscale machines, it can be used by nanoscale machines without violating the second law of thermodynamics.
